Why Conveyor Belt Safety Switches are Essential

Conveyor belt safety switches are essential components of conveyor systems because they provide a proactive approach to safety management. These switches are strategically placed at critical points along the conveyor belt line to monitor various conditions, such as belt misalignment, speed deviation, and jamming. When the safety switch detects any deviation from the normal operating conditions, it triggers an alarm or stops the conveyor system altogether, preventing potential accidents or damage to equipment. By incorporating safety switches into their conveyor systems, companies can mitigate risks, protect their assets, and ensure a safe working environment for employees.

Types of Conveyor Belt Safety Switches

There are several types of safety switches that can be used in conveyor systems to enhance operational safety. Some common types include pull cord switches, belt misalignment switches, speed switches, and zero speed switches. Pull cord switches are manually operated devices that workers can pull in case of an emergency to stop the conveyor immediately. Belt misalignment switches detect any deviation in the position of the conveyor belt and trigger an alarm or shutdown the system to prevent damage. Speed switches monitor the speed of the conveyor belt and can alert operators or stop the system if it exceeds or falls below the set limit. Zero speed switches detect when the conveyor belt comes to a complete stop and ensure that it remains inactivated until the issue is resolved.

Best Practices for Implementing Conveyor Belt Safety Switches

When implementing conveyor belt safety switches, it is essential to follow best practices to maximize their effectiveness and ensure optimal safety in the workplace. Companies should conduct a thorough risk assessment of their conveyor systems to identify potential hazards and determine the most appropriate safety switches to install. It is crucial to regularly inspect and maintain safety switches to ensure they are functioning correctly and respond promptly to any issues. Training employees on the proper use of safety switches and emergency procedures is also vital to enhancing safety awareness and preventing accidents. By following best practices for implementing safety switches, companies can create a safe and secure working environment for their employees.
